On other machines I've used, I've been able to Go TOOLS>ENVELOPES AND LABELS>NEW DOCUMENTS and a document would come up on the screen that was preset to three labels across and however many down, so I could type out as many different labels as I needed. When I try and do this on my MS office setup, I have nothing outlined and no labels preset. How can I make this do what my old MS office 95 could?
 
It still does this, so I must assume that you don't have table gridlines
displayed - check the option from the table menu.

I added gridlines, and I have four rows that have no columns. How do I correct the settings to have 3 columns of ten rows with a label size of 2 5/8" X 1"?
 
You must select the correct label type to begin with. On the Labels tab of
the Tools | Envelopes and Labels dialog, click the Options... button and
select the appropriate stock number for your labels. Then click the New
Document button.

That didn't work. I selected the mini address labels (1"x 2.63") and I still have four huge rows with no rows coming up.
 
Avery's mini-sheets have only one column of labels. For example, if you will
look at the details for the one you chose, 2160, you'll see that it
specifies 1 label across and 4 down.

You need to select the actual stock number of your labels. For example, if
you will select 5160 instead, you'll get labels with 3 across and 10 down.
